Social innovation thriving on hybridity? lessons from a street paper project for people experiencing homelessness in germany

HIGHLIGHTS

  • What: This work shows how organisational processes draw on various imaginaries - for instance those inherent in market interaction; charitable activities; or state administration - and may also combine productive and political activities (Evers 2020). The case study this article is drawing on is based on different sorts of evidence . The project under study was set up in the 1990s with the aim of creating a magazine to be sold by people experiencing homelessnes (or similar hardship) on the streets.
